This position is responsible for performing HR-related duties on a professional level and works closely with HR management in supporting designated geographic regions.
This position carries out responsibilities in pre-employment testing, onboarding, departmental training including new employee orientation and safety training, Workers Compensation, FMLA and develops and produces employee communication materials to improve employee engagement and understanding of company policy and procedures.
ONBOARDING – HUMAN RESOURCES
· Coordinate and communicate with on-site Managers/Directors regarding pre-employment testing for departmental new hires.
· Perform necessary background checks on departmental new hires.
· Follow up with necessary clinics to expedite all pre-employment test results and ensure all results are reported in a timely manner.
· Launch onboarding for new hires and coordinate onboarding process with managers/directors.
· Verify completion of new hires onboarding to ensure payroll processing is completed.
· Ensure all state required employee records are forwarded to Managers/Directors to ensure onsite personnel files comply for site visits.
TRAINING
· Train all new hiring managers on hiring process, onboarding process, payroll process and other HR and company policy and procedures within first week of employment.
· Provide safety orientation with all new property managers upon hire and once a quarter.
· Assist new managers with first payroll processing.
· Follow up with new managers to provide additional training if needed.
· Conduct 30, 60 and 90 Follow Up with departmental new hires.
· Conduct exit interviews.
· Additional training assignments.
WORKERS COMPENSATION, FMLA & LEAVE OF ABSENCES, SAFETY
· Assist Managers/Directors in directing injured Employees to proper clinic or ER for medical attention.
· Report workers compensation claims to appropriate insurance company.
· Follow up with employees on work status, review and maintain return to work records.
· Work with workers compensation adjusters, prepare bona fide job offers for light duty assignments and other documents required by insurance company.
· Communicate with injured employees to ensure all medical appointments are met and proper documentation is received from clinics.
· Handle FMLA and personal Leave of Absences request.
· Process and ensured FMLA required documents are sent and received by due dates within federal guidelines.
· Track and assist employees who are on FMLA or Personal LOA.
· Coordinate safety and other required training to maintain OSHA and multi-state compliance.
· Track and documents monthly safety meetings and other required training for all locations.
